0

私はすでに以下のコードを持っています

var input = document.getElementById("documentlink");
input.style.color = "blue";
input.style.textDecoration = "underline";


input.onclick = function () {
   if (Xrm.Page.getAttribute("documentlink").getValue() != null)
        window.open(Xrm.Page.getAttribute("documentlink").getValue());
}

ただし、ここでの問題は、カスタム コード検証ツールが textDecoration を問題として識別するため、アップグレードで問題になる可能性があるため、html DOM を使用できないことです。絶対 URL を与えるため、そのテキスト ボックス形式を URL にすることはできず、既存のフィールドのタイプを変更することはできません。これを行う方法があれば、助けてください。

4

1 に答える 1

0

はい、目標を達成する方法はたくさんあります。

  1. 開く URL をクリックすると、リボン ボタンを追加できます。
  2. フィールドに/から情報を保存/読み取ることができ、フォーマットが必要なカスタム html Web リソースを作成できます。Html/Js webresources の開発と crm フォームへの埋め込みについて簡単に説明します - http://a33ik.blogspot.com/2015/03/howto-htmljs-webresources.html
于 2015-05-21T07:20:32.047 に答える